## Introduce per-tenant rate quotas in the Orvane gateway

For the release manager: this change replaces our global throttle with per-tenant quotas, resolved at request time from the tenant registry and cached for sixty seconds. Tenants without an explicit quota inherit the tier default; overage returns a retryable status with a hint header. Rollout is gated behind a flag, defaulting off, and the old throttle remains as a backstop until two clean release cycles pass.

The initial tier defaults we intend to ship are listed below.

limits module of taguf-hafog:
WEIGHTS = {
    "wenox": 690,
    "wenok": 782,
    "kelax": 41,
    "holox": 338,
    "quenir": 39,
}

## Build provenance: Glimmerhive profile-store sharding

Quick note for plugin authors: every sharded build of the Glimmerhive user-profile store is produced by the Kilnworth pipeline, which stamps the shard-map version into the artifact metadata. If your plugin reads profile shards directly (please don't, but we know some of you do), check that stamp before assuming ring layout. The provenance record for the current rollout starts with the token below.

session token of tajef-bageg = htk21_5d90d574934f3ccae6437

## Runbook: Upgrading the Ferrowick Message Broker

Before upgrading from 4.x to 5.x, drain all consumers and confirm queue depth reads zero on the Oxhollow dashboard. Take a snapshot of the broker data directory — rollback without it is painful. The 5.x config drops `BROKER_LEGACY_ACK`, so remove it from the env file, and verify `BROKER_HEARTBEAT_SECS` is 30 or lower. The new version also authenticates inter-node traffic with a cluster secret, which must be set in the env file on the very next line.

sealed setting: ARCHIVE_KEY3=8d0

Handover note — Crumbwheel order cutoffs.

Welcome aboard. The bakery cutoff rule in Crumbwheel closes same-day orders at 14:00 local to each storefront, not UTC — this has bitten us twice. Holiday overrides live in the calendar service and take precedence silently, so always check there first when a cutoff looks wrong. To unlock the calendar service's admin console after a restart, enter the recovery passphrase below.

vault phrase of bagap-bahaf = silion-pelox-sorox-casdor-quenwyn-fraax-eliox-praael-kelion-quenvan-kasox-rusael-norius-belvan